1lbchicken thighs or breast450g, cut into strips; tofu or tempeh works for vegetarian
salt & pepperto taste
Honey Glaze
1tbspoil (olive or vegetable)avocado oil works too
1/4cupsoy sauceuse coconut aminos for gluten-free
1/4cuphoneybrown sugar or maple syrup in a pinch
2tbsprice vinegarapple cider vinegar works too
2clovesgarlic, minceduse 1 tsp garlic powder if needed
1tspfresh ginger, gratedor 1/2 tsp ground ginger
Thickening Slurry
1tspcornstarcharrowroot works for paleo
1tbspwater
Instructions
Lightly season the chicken strips with salt and pepper.Heat the o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add the chicken and sear for 5–6 minutes until golden and cooked through.
In a bowl, combine soy sauce, honey, vinegar, garlic, and ginger. Whisk until smooth.
Pour the glaze mixture over the cooked chicken. Let it simmer for 2–3 minutes, stirring continuously to coat every piece.
Mix the cornstarch and water separately to form a slurry, then drizzle it into the pan while stirring. Allow the sauce to thicken into a glossy coating.
Let the sauce bubble for 1 additional minute to develop that signature sticky texture and deep caramel color.
Notes
Use low-sodium soy sauce to reduce overall sodium. Add chili flakes for heat or sesame seeds for extra texture.
